The dial, case, and movement are signed by Croton. The bezel is in overall good condition with scratches and wear to the outer edge while having aged to a greenish color in some light. The lume on the dial and hands has developed a pleasing creamy patina. The hands are in good condition with some patina spilling over onto the metal portion from the lume. The dial is in good condition with a slight patina to the finish. The caseback engravings are visible, including the numbers. The facets of the lugs are clearly visible. The case is strong with scratches and slight nicks throughout. This example is in overall good, attractive condition. We paired this Croton Nivada Grenchen with our Textured Tan Calfskin watch strap to play off of the color of the lume in the hands and on the dial.ĭimensions: 38mm diameter 13mm thicknessĬaliber: Venus, manually-wound, caliber 210īracelet/Strap: HODINKEE Textured Tan Calfskin Watch Strap The originally black bezel has aged to a beautiful dark greenish color depending on the light. The radium lume on the dial and hands has aged to that dark yellow, creamy color that vintage collectors just can't get enough of, while the surface of the dial remains a crisp matte black. These include the double signed "Croton Nivada Grenchen" dial, radium lume-filled broad arrow-style hands, the "high swiss," and the "chronograph" at six o'clock rather than the standard "chronomaster" branding.īeyond technical intrigue, this example has that look that only a well-used vintage watch can possess. Today's watch is a "first series" and considered to be more desirable than your conventional Chronomaster for a combination of characteristics. The Chronomaster was produced in a wide variety of case, dial, and movement executions throughout its productions years. These pieces were branded simply as Croton or Croton Nivada Grenchen, with the most popular models being the Antarctic and the Chronomaster Aviator Sea Diver. Due to slightly similar names, a battle played out in between Movado, already well established in the US at the time, and Nivada, resulting in Croton stepping in as the US distributor of Nivada-made watches. Nivada stuck to mainly European markets until attempting an expansion to sell into the American sector in the 1940s. Nivada (of) Grenchen dates back to 1879 in the small Swiss town of, well, Grenchen. Croton was founded in New York City as an American watch company focused on importing and distributing high quality watches to their home market. In a collaboration at least 50 years ahead of its time, the name is actually two brands smashed together. Most often found branded as Chronomaster on the dial, this do-it-all vintage chronograph from Croton x Nivada Grenchen offers a regatta timer, tachymeter scale, and rotating bezel.Ĭroton Nivada Grenchen is a long winded brand name, especially when printed on a watch dial.
